I’m sad that LP palm now does 90 damage, and Cr. FP does 80.
The following combos work that didn’t work before:
In The Corner:
-
J.FP (or w/e else, DF dive kick, take your pick) > Cr.FP xx LP. Hadoken > Cr. FP xx LP Hadoken > Sweep (You can use Close FP in place of Cr.FP for more damage)
-
J.FP (or w/e else) > Close MP > Cr.FP xx LP Hadoken xx FADC > Close MP > Cr. FP xx LP Hadoken > Sweep
-
J.FP (or w/e else) > Close MP > Cr.FP xx LP Hadoken xx FADC > Close FP xx EX Tatsu
-
J.FP (or w/e else) > Close MP xx LP Hadoken > Cr.FP xx MP Palm or EX Palm (connects on Yun, but it can be wonky)
-
J.FP (or w/e else) > Close MP xx LP Hadoken > Cr.MP xx EX Tatsu (connects on Yun)
For BIG damage (still in the corner):
-
J.FP (or w/e else) > Close MP xx LP Hadoken > Cr.FP xx LP Hadoken xx FADC > Close FP xx EX Palm > U1 (or reset if you so choose)
-
J.FP (or w/e else) > Close MP xx LP Hadoken > Cr.FP xx LP Hadoken xx FADC > Close MP xx LP Hadoken > Cr.FP xx LP Hadoken > Sweep
-
J.FP (or w/e else) > Close MP xx LP Hadoken > Cr.FP xx LP Hadoken xx FADC > Close MP > Cr. FP xx MP Palm (or EX Palm > U1)
I found quite a few more, especially mid-screen and will add them in later with video.
EDIT: And since Cr. FP xx LP Hadoken xx FADC > Cr. FP xx LP Palm no longer works mid-screen you can do the following FADC combos with the new LP palm @ mid-screen. Don’t know if using LP palm is worth it since at these ranges the more powerful (by 40 damage) MP palm will connect, but it’s up to you.
-
J.FP (or w/e else) > Close FP xx LP Hadoken xx FADC > Close FP xx LP Palm (or MP/EX palm)
-
J.FP (or w/e else) > Close MP xx LP Hadoken xx FADC > Close FP xx LP Palm (or MP/EX palm)

If your opponent is in the habit of jumping backwards and kicking you out of the air when you demon flip, you can parry and EX tatsu for a full punish. I only tested on Ryu but it works with neutral jump and forward jump as well.
***j.mp>mid-air tatsu ***:
On jump-in works on all standing characters not just tall ones, It even works on some crouching opponents too(if you want to see the lowest air tatsu possible!). i tried it on a bunch of guys last night, you must hit the jmp so that its not meaty. There are just some guys who like Guile who when non-blocking but crouching will never be hit by a jump-in mp, in this case and others like it it will not work unless they are blocking, then the jump-in mp will stand them up and the mid-air tatsu will start…
